Businesses today operate in a digital-first world where a strong online presence is no longer optional; it is essential.
Many companies are choosing to outsource web development instead of maintaining costly in-house teams.
Outsourcing is no longer just a cost-saving tactic. It has evolved into a strategic decision that gives businesses access to global talent, advanced technologies, specialised skills, and faster project delivery.
However, many organisations still feel unsure about how to outsource web development effectively, how to choose the right partner, and what pitfalls to avoid.
This guide walks you through everything you need to know about web development outsourcing, step by step.
Why Companies Are Outsourcing Web Development

The decision to outsource today is shaped less by preference and more by the realities of the global digital economy. Companies are responding to major shifts in technology, workforce availability, and customer expectations that make outsourcing not just helpful—but necessary.
1. Technology Is Evolving Faster Than Internal Teams Can Keep Up
Every year introduces new frameworks, security protocols, programming languages, design systems, and integrations. Most businesses cannot continuously train internal teams at the pace the industry demands, pushing them toward external experts who specialise in rapid technological adaptation.
2. A Global Shortage of Senior Developers
The tech industry is facing a real talent deficit—especially for experienced backend engineers, DevOps specialists, cloud architects, and full-stack developers. Many companies simply cannot fill critical roles internally, making web development outsourcing the only way to keep projects moving.
3. Increasing Pressure for Continuous Digital Presence
Websites are no longer “build once and forget.” They now require:
- Frequent updates
- Feature rollouts
- Performance optimisation
- Security patches
Internal teams often struggle with the constant workload, creating a push towards outsourcing web development companies that can manage continuous development cycles.
4. Higher Expectations for Customer Experience
Customers expect seamless navigation, fast loading, personalisation, and flawless responsiveness. Achieving such standards requires deep technical specialisation, often beyond what general in-house teams can provide.
5. Businesses Are Expanding Digitally Faster Than They Expand Manpower
Many companies grow online far quicker than they grow their internal workforce. When digital operations scale rapidly—new landing pages, campaigns, portals, digital products—outsourcing becomes the practical solution to avoid bottlenecks.
6. Globalisation Has Normalised Cross-Border Collaboration
The pandemic accelerated the remote work culture, dissolving geographical constraints. Businesses are now far more open to collaborating with global teams, turning outsourcing into a mainstream operational model rather than an exception.
7. Cybersecurity Requirements Have Become More Complex
Modern websites must comply with stricter data regulations, encryption standards, and security audits. Companies lacking internal cybersecurity capabilities rely on specialised development partners with advanced security knowledge.
8. Digital Competition Is Fierce
Every industry now competes online. To stay relevant, businesses need to launch faster, update frequently, and innovate boldly—demands that internal teams often can’t meet alone.
Types of Web Development Services You Can Outsource
Before learning how to outsource web development, it’s essential to understand what services can be outsourced. Almost every aspect of web development can be handled externally:
● Frontend Development
Creating visually appealing, user-friendly, and responsive interfaces.
● Backend Development
Building secure, scalable, and high-performing server-side systems.
● Full-Stack Development
A blend of frontend and backend expertise for end-to-end solutions.
● eCommerce Website Development Services
For online stores built on Shopify, Magento, WooCommerce, BigCommerce, and more.
● CMS Development
Custom WordPress, Webflow, Drupal, or Joomla solutions.
● Web App Development
Custom platforms, SaaS products, portals, and enterprise-level systems.
● UX/UI Design
Wireframes, prototypes, and human-centred design.
● QA & Testing
Functional testing, performance testing, and bug fixing.
● Website Maintenance & Support
Security updates, backups, performance optimisation, and upgrades.
Get expert web development support with zero hassle
How to Outsource Web Development - Step-by-Step Guide:
To get the best results, your outsourcing journey should follow a structured approach. Here’s a detailed blueprint:
1. Define Your Project Requirements Clearly
Before approaching any outsourcing web development company, outline:
- The project goal
- Core features
- Technology preferences (if any)
- Timeline expectations
- Budget range
- Target audience and user journey
A detailed project brief ensures the development team fully understands your vision.
2. Choose the Right Outsourcing Model
There are three common models for outsource web development services:
a. Project-Based Outsourcing
Best for businesses with well-defined projects and fixed requirements.
b. Dedicated Team Model
An extended offshore team works exclusively on your project.
c. Staff Augmentation
Hire specific developers or designers to join your existing internal team.
Select the model that aligns with your project size, complexity, and long-term needs.
3. Shortlist the Best Web Development Outsourcing Partners
Evaluate each company based on:
- Portfolio and case studies
- Industry experience
- Client testimonials
- Team size and skill set
- Communication style
- Development methodology (Agile, Scrum, etc.)
A reliable partner should have proven experience in handling web development projects outsourcing.
4. Conduct Interviews and Technical Evaluations
Don’t hesitate to ask technical questions or request a sample task. This helps you check:
- Problem-solving skills
- Coding quality
- Communication clarity
- Technology proficiency
5. Discuss Budget and Contract Terms
Be transparent about your budget and confirm:
- Pricing model (fixed, hourly, or retainer)
- Payment milestones
- Project timeline
- Intellectual property rights
- Confidentiality agreements
Clear agreements prevent disputes during development.
6. Establish Communication Channels
Effective communication is crucial for successful outsourcing. Agree on:
- Preferred platforms (Slack, Zoom, Teams, Jira)
- Frequency of updates
- Reporting structure
- Project management tools
A good outsourcing web development company will ensure smooth collaboration regardless of time zones.
7. Begin Development with Clear Milestones
Break the project into phases:
- Discovery
- Design
- Development
- Testing
- Deployment
Each milestone should have defined deliverables and timelines.
8. Test Thoroughly Before Launch
Never skip this step. Ensure the website undergoes:
- Functional testing
- Security testing
- Device compatibility checks
- Page speed optimisation
- User acceptance testing
9. Ensure Post-Launch Maintenance
Websites require ongoing support. Clarify maintenance packages or monthly retainer options with your development partner.
Benefits of Outsourcing Web Development Services

1. Higher Quality Output
Specialised agencies bring years of experience, industry insights, and advanced tools that elevate the final product.
2. Consistent Scalability
Need to add new developers midway? Outsourcing makes it possible without delays or hiring struggles.
3. Reduced Management Burden
Agencies come with project managers who ensure smooth execution while you focus on essentials.
4. Continuous Innovation
When you outsource web programming, you gain access to the latest technologies, frameworks, and trends.
Get high-quality web development delivered effortlessly
Common Mistakes to Avoid When Outsourcing Web Development
To achieve the best results, avoid these frequent pitfalls:
• Choosing Based on the Lowest Price
Cheap development often leads to poor quality, delays, or hidden costs.
• Vague Communication
Ambiguous instructions lead to misalignment and rework.
• Undefined Scope of Work
Always document every feature to prevent scope creep.
• Ignoring Security Measures
Confirm the outsourcing partner follows best practices for data privacy and cybersecurity.
• No Post-Launch Plan
Maintenance is as important as development—never skip it.
How Much Does It Cost to Outsource Web Development?
Pricing varies depending on:
- Project complexity
- Features required
- Technology stack
- Developer expertise
- Engagement model
On average, outsourcing web development company partners might charge:
- Simple websites: Lower range
- Corporate websites: Mid-range
- eCommerce & SaaS platforms: Higher range
The value lies not only in cost savings but in expertise, speed, and long-term scalability.
When Should You Outsource Web Development?
Outsourcing is ideal when:
- You don’t have an in-house technical team.
- You need faster delivery.
- The project demands specialised technology expertise.
- You want to reduce operational costs.
- You require ongoing support and upgrades.
- Your business wants to scale quickly.
If any of these match your situation, outsourcing web development services is the right choice.
Final Thoughts: Outsourcing Web Development the Right Way
Outsourcing is no longer a backup plan—it’s a strategic move that accelerates digital transformation. By choosing the right partner, defining clear goals, and maintaining transparent communication, your organisation can unlock enormous value from web development outsourcing.
Whether you want to build a high-performance website, revamp an existing platform, or launch a next-gen digital product, collaborating with a professional outsourcing web development company gives you the confidence to scale without limitations.
With the right approach, you don’t just outsource web development—you gain a long-term technical partner that supports your growth.
Access expert service in your convenience
FAQs
What does outsourcing web development mean?
It means hiring an external team or agency to build or maintain your website instead of using an in-house team.
How do I choose the right outsourcing company?
Check their portfolio, experience, reviews, technical skills, and communication process before deciding.
What web development tasks can be outsourced?
You can outsource design, coding, testing, maintenance, eCommerce sites, CMS development, and custom web apps.
Is outsourcing web development cost-effective?
Yes. It reduces hiring costs and lets you pay only for the services you need.
How do I ensure good quality when outsourcing?
Set clear requirements, review work regularly, use project tracking tools, and choose a reliable, proven partner.




